When Mike McCarthy told Matt Hasselbeck that he needs to buy a truck and build a house to send a message, frankly, the young quarterback thought his position coach was nuts.

McCarthy essentially could’ve told the balding second-year pro to bench press 315 pounds with no spotter.

The Packers longshot, however, earned the No. 2 job behind Brett Favre… was soon handpicked by Mike Holmgren to lead the Seattle Seahawks… and enjoyed an NFL career that spanned from 1998 through 2015. Surely, the Seahawks fans that watch this podcast will forever believe Hasselbeck was robbed of a Super Bowl in 2005, too. (He holds no grudges.)
